Supply Width

The width of your loaded supply. Choices include 1.20, 1.50,

 

or 2.00 inches.

Field Type

Choices include text, bar code, constant text, and line.

Field Class

Choices include simple, price, system date/time, and combo.

 

Price and system date/time fields are explained in Chapter 9,

 

“Defining Special Fields.” Combo (combination) fields are

 

explained later in this chapter. Simple fields are the most

 

commonly used.

Type of Data

Choices include alphanumeric and numeric. Decide if you

 

need letters or letters and numbers in your field. When

 

selecting a font for your data, keep in mind that point sizes

 

greater than 12 include only the following characters:

 

0123456789#$%&(),./@DFKLMPS\kprö¢£¥

Maximum Length

The maximum number of characters in the field. The number

 

of characters depends on the font size, label size, whether

 

you are using a check digit, or if the field is printed

 

horizontally or vertically. If your data is a price, remember to

 

include the currency symbol (dollar sign, cent sign, etc.) in the

 

length of your field. The range is 0 – 40.

Minimum Length

The minimum number of characters in the field.

 

The range is 0 – 40.

Field Prompt

Contains the prompt displayed during data entry. The

 

maximum number of characters is 40.

Fixed Data

In situations where the same data appears on all labels, you

 

can enter the repetitive data as fixed data. The operator does

 

not enter the data. The maximum number of characters is 40;

 

however, each field has a maximum length defined, so the

 

fixed data must be below that maximum.

 

Fixed data is stored with the format and automatically

 

displayed with the prompt during data entry. Fixed data can

 

also be added before or after entry characters.

 

An example of fixed data is the manufacturer’s code in a

 

UPCA bar code.

Paxar 6035 is a high-performance thermal transfer printer designed to meet the demanding requirements of various labeling applications, particularly in the retail, logistics, and manufacturing sectors. This printer is celebrated for its reliability, efficiency, and versatility, making it a popular choice among businesses looking to streamline their labeling processes.

One of the main features of the Paxar 6035 is its advanced printing technology. It utilizes thermal transfer printing, which ensures high-quality, durable labels that can withstand different environmental conditions. The printer's resolution of up to 300 dpi guarantees crisp and clear images, barcodes, and text, enhancing readability and scannability. This level of detail is vital for companies that require precise labeling to maintain inventory accuracy and compliance with regulations.

The Paxar 6035 boasts a user-friendly interface that simplifies operation. It is equipped with an intuitive LCD display, allowing operators to easily navigate through various settings and functions. The printer supports multiple connectivity options, including USB, Ethernet, and serial ports, ensuring seamless integration with existing systems and enabling efficient data transfer.

Another notable characteristic of the Paxar 6035 is its robust construction, designed for heavy-duty usage. Built to withstand the rigors of industrial environments, this printer features a durable casing and reliable internal components, ensuring long-lasting performance. Furthermore, it is engineered for easy maintenance. Users can quickly replace ink ribbons and label rolls without extensive downtime, enhancing overall productivity.

In terms of labeling capabilities, the Paxar 6035 supports a wide range of label sizes and types. Whether creating small barcode labels or large shipping labels, this printer can accommodate different requirements with ease. Additionally, its compatibility with various labeling software makes it a versatile choice for businesses seeking custom labeling solutions.
